Condividi tramite


PRIVILEGI DI RIPRISTINO MSCK

Si applica a: segno di spunta sì Databricks SQL segno di spunta sì Databricks Runtime

Rimuove tutti i privilegi da tutti gli utenti associati all'oggetto .

Usare questa istruzione per pulire il controllo di accesso residuo lasciato indietro dopo che gli oggetti sono stati eliminati dal metastore Hive all'esterno di Databricks SQL o Databricks Runtime.

Sintassi

MSCK REPAIR object PRIVILEGES

object
  { [ SCHEMA | DATABASE ] schema_name |
    FUNCTION function_name |
    TABLE table_name
    VIEW view_name |
    ANONYMOUS FUNCTION |
    ANY FILE }

Parametri

  • schema_name

    Assegna un nome allo schema da cui vengono rimossi i privilegi.

  • function_name

    Assegna un nome alla funzione da cui vengono rimossi i privilegi.

  • table_name

    Assegna un nome alla tabella da cui vengono rimossi i privilegi.

  • view_name

    Assegna un nome alla visualizzazione da cui vengono rimossi i privilegi.

  • ANY FILE

    Revoca i ANY FILE privilegi a tutti gli utenti.

  • FUNZIONE ANONIMA

    Revoca i ANONYMOUS FUNCTION privilegi a tutti gli utenti.

Esempi

> MSCK REPAIR SCHEMA gone_from_hive PRIVILEGES;

> MSCK REPAIR ANONYMOUS FUNCTION PRIVILEGES;

> MSCK REPAIR TABLE default.dropped PRIVILEGES;